物联网软件开发如何解决跨协议兼容性问题?
#技术教程 发布时间: 2025-03-11
协议标准化与统一框架
物联网软件开发中,采用标准化协议是实现跨协议兼容的首要方案。通过建立统一的通信框架,整合MQTT、CoAP等主流协议,可有效解决设备间的互操作难题。典型技术实现包括:

- 构建协议转换网关,支持多种协议报文解析
- 制定扩展性强的元数据描述规范
- 开发协议兼容性测试套件
中间件技术实现协议转换
中间件层在物联网架构中扮演关键角色,通过抽象设备通信接口实现协议解耦。基于动态插件机制,可灵活接入不同厂商设备的私有协议。主要技术特征包括:
- 协议解析引擎支持语法树动态生成
- 消息队列实现异步通信缓冲
- 协议转换规则可视化配置
跨平台开发技术应用
采用React Native、Flutter等跨平台框架,可有效统一不同操作系统的协议实现差异。通过抽象硬件访问层,屏蔽底层通信协议差异。关键技术包括:
- 设备通信接口标准化封装
- 协议选择动态决策算法
- 自适应网络环境的质量监控
动态协议适配机制
基于元数据驱动的协议适配系统可自动识别设备协议特征。通过协议描述语言(PDL)定义通信规范,实现运行时动态协议绑定。典型架构包含:
- 协议特征指纹库
- 语义解析中间件
- QoS动态调节模块
物联网跨协议兼容性解决方案需融合标准化建设与技术突破。通过建立分层解耦架构,结合动态适配机制与统一开发框架,可有效应对设备异构性挑战。未来发展方向将聚焦协议智能化识别与自主协商技术。
# 化与
# 自动识别
# item_btn
# span
# amount
# intr_b
# intr_t
# item_intr
# fanw
# 标准化建设
# 异构
# 通信协议
# 应对策略
# 自适应
# 未来发展
# 绑定
# 如何解决
# 套件
# 建站
# time
上一篇 : 独立域名自助建站系统:一站式注册与模板建站高效解决方案
下一篇 : 物联网系统开发中的低功耗通信技术如何选择?
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!